Health risk assessment of uranium in drinking water in Hyderabad

Description

Main source of drinking water supply in the twin city of Hyderabad and Secunderabad are the river dam and rain water collection dams, Uranium in different drinking water samples from source dams and user points in twin cities are analyzed. Municipal supply water samples are also analyzed with regular periodicity throughout the year. The geometric mean (GM) uranium concentration of last ten years is found to be 0.69 ppb with geometric standard deviation of 2.58. The GM of uranium concentration in drinking water source dams water is 0.91 ppb. For drinking water samples at user point the GM of uranium concentration is 0.49 ppb. Lifetime average daily dose of uranium in drinking water was observed to be 0.03 μg.kg-1day-1 compared to the Reference Dose of 0.6 μg.kg-1day-1. It is concluded that health risk is minimal due to exposure to uranium in drinking water. However, the concentration of uranium in drinking water must be monitored regularly. (author)
